Zenit St Petersburg WWWDWD 📈
Zenit St Petersburg prepare for this match following a 0-0 Premier League tied result against Lokomotiv Moscow.
In that match, Zenit St Petersburg managed 60% possession and 12 attempts on goal with 1 on target. Lokomotiv Moscow got 13 attempts on goal with 5 on target.
Their most recent results really do illustrate the point that huge efforts have been put in by the Zenit St Petersburg backline. Zenit St Petersburg have given the opposition little, resulting in the total number of goals that have flown into the back of their net over the course of their previous 6 clashes standing at 3. That trend won’t necessarily be continued here, however.
Coming into this contest, Zenit St Petersburg are unbeaten in their previous 19 home league matches. An amazing run.
Terek Grozny DWLDLD
Previously, Terek Grozny drew 1-1 in the Premier League match with Baltika Kaliningrad.
In that game, Terek Grozny had 57% possession and 6 attempts on goal with 1 on target. For their opponents, Baltika Kaliningrad got 15 shots at goal with 6 of them on target. Lacerda (51') and Kevin Andrade (60' Own goal) scored for Baltika Kaliningrad.
The stats don’t lie, and Terek Grozny have been scored against in 5 of their last 6 matches, conceding 9 goals overall. In defence, Terek Grozny have not been doing too well.
Their past results show that Terek Grozny:
- have not registered a win against Zenit St Petersburg when they have played them away from home in the previous 2 league games.
- are without an away win for the past 8 matches in the league. Their travelling support will be needed here, for sure.
👥 Head to head
Checking on their most recent head-to-head clashes stretching back to 05/11/2022 tells us that Zenit St Petersburg have won 4 of these & Terek Grozny 2, with the number of draws being 0.
In all, 19 goals were scored between the two sides in this period, with 13 for Sine-Belo-Golubye and 6 belonging to The Wolves. That is an average goals per game value of 3.17.
The previous league meeting between these clubs was Premier League match day 4 on 09/08/2025 when it finished Terek Grozny 1-0 Zenit St Petersburg.
In that game, Terek Grozny managed 26% possession and 9 shots on goal with 2 of them on target.
Zenit St Petersburg got 12 attempts on goal with 3 on target. Vanja Drkušić (30' Own goal) scored.
The match was refereed by Evgeni Bulanov.
